Description

Structural transformation has long been a powerful engine of growth and job creation in developing countries. However, traditional development aid is often found to be inadequate in addressing the bottlenecks that hinder this process.

This book offers a new perspective on South-South development aid and cooperation by examining it through the lens of structural transformation. The authors draw on successful economic transformations in countries such as China and South Korea, and present new ideas from emerging market economies like Brazil and India.

By exploring 'multiple win' solutions based on comparative advantages and economy of scale, this book aims to broaden the ongoing discussions of post-2015 development aid and cooperation.
